Simply whisk together
apple cider vinegar and a dab
of mustard, then drizzle
in oil
of choice (remember, use a 3:1 ratio, so if you have 1
tablespoon of vinegar, use 3
tablespoons of oil, which should be good for a night
of salad for two or three), whisking aggressively the whole time.
When 7 women with PCOS took 15 grams (1
Tablespoon)
of apple cider vinegar, 4 resumed ovulating within 40 days, 6 experienced a measurable reduction
in insulin resistance, and 5 had a decrease
in their LH / FSH ratio (24).
